Our World in Data

Our World in Data is a website that helps people understand how the world is changing by using reliable data, research, and visual information. The platform collects statistics from many trusted sources and presents them through clear charts, maps, and short explanations so that complex global topics are easier to understand. Instead of reading long academic reports, users can explore interactive graphs that show trends over time and compare information between countries.

The website covers many important global issues, such as poverty, health, education, climate change, food production, energy, and technology. By looking at the data and visualizations, people can see how different aspects of the world have improved or changed over the years. For example, the site can show how life expectancy has increased in many countries, how extreme poverty has declined globally, or how carbon dioxide emissions differ around the world.

The goal of the project is to make scientific research and global data accessible to everyone, including students, teachers, journalists, and the general public. By presenting information in a clear and visual way, the platform helps people better understand the biggest challenges facing humanity and the progress that has been made to solve them. The project was created by researcher Max Roser and is connected to the University of Oxford. Overall, it is an educational resource designed to help people learn about the world through data and evidence.

Etymonline: Online Etymology Dictionary

Etymonline is a popular online resource dedicated to the origins and history of English words. Rather than just providing definitions, this site traces how words have developed over time, revealing where they came from, how their meanings have changed, and how different languages have influenced English. It’s essentially an etymological dictionary — a tool that explores the roots of words in Old English, Latin, Greek, and other source languages, and shows how they evolved into the forms we use today.

Writers, teachers, students, and language lovers often turn to Etymonline when they want to understand not just what a word means, but why it means that, and how its usage reflects centuries of linguistic change. The entries are presented in a clear, accessible way, often with examples from historical texts and comparisons to related terms in other languages. Whether you’re curious about a specific word’s background or want to explore the fascinating story of English vocabulary, Etymonline offers a rich and approachable way to unlock the deeper history behind everyday language.

Collection of Canadian language resources

The Resources of the Language Portal of Canada is a freely accessible online hub created by the Government of Canada to support language learning, communication and writing in the country’s two official languages, English and French, as well as to provide links to a wide range of related tools and materials. 

The “Language learning” section of this resource includes curated links to courses, programs, and learning materials designed to help people study English and French. Within this section you can find options for both formal language programs and self-study resources, including study tools and teaching aids that support learners at different levels. This makes it useful for students, teachers, and anyone who wants to improve their skills in one of Canada’s official languages. 

The website links to other helpful materials such as writing guides, glossaries, dictionaries, inclusive language resources and Indigenous language resources, so users interested in broadening their linguistic knowledge can explore beyond basic learning.

ESLfriend.com

ESLfriend.com is an online platform offering free ESL resources, including handouts, lessons, activities, and full lesson-sets for English language teaching and learning. The site describes itself as providing materials ranging from daily conversation and grammar to business English and test preparation. 

One of the major strengths of ESLfriend is its breadth of content: there are materials for a variety of levels, topics and uses — from conversation starters to full lesson packs. For teachers, this means a ready-made resource library to draw on, reducing preparation time. For learners, the materials can offer extra practice outside class. Another plus is the free access to most of the materials, making it accessible for educators and students with limited budget.

The site also includes media-based lessons (reading passages, audio, discussion questions) which are useful for integrating skills (reading, speaking, listening) rather than only grammar.

The Conversation UK

The UK edition of The Conversation is an independent online news platform where articles are written by academics and researchers in collaboration with professional editors.

The goal is to provide fact-based, accessible, and reliable journalism, free from paywalls and not driven by advertising. Articles often explain complex issues (politics, science, health, technology, environment, arts, education, etc.) in clear, plain language, making research and expertise understandable to a wide audience.

The UK edition focuses on issues particularly relevant to Britain but also covers global topics. It’s widely used by teachers, students, journalists, and policymakers because it combines academic rigor with approachable writing.

Teachers can use articles as up-to-date, reliable resources for classroom discussions. Students can read expert explanations of current affairs and research in accessible language. It can also support critical thinking and media literacy by showing how experts communicate knowledge.

Ambiente Virtual de Idiomas #UNAM #English

This resource is part of the Ambiente Virtual de Idiomas (AVI) created by UNAM, a major university in Mexico. It is a free online platform that helps anyone practice and improve their English skills, even if they are not students at UNAM. 

The “Practice” section includes lots of lessons and interactive activities organized by levels (from beginner A1 to upper-intermediate B2), based on international language standards. You can practice reading, writing, listening, and speaking with guided exercises.

Each unit includes clear explanations, audio clips, quizzes, and sometimes even speaking exercises where you can record yourself. You don’t need to create an account or log in — you can just visit the site and start learning. It’s great for people who want to study English at their own pace, whether they’re just starting or want to improve their grammar, vocabulary, or pronunciation. The design is simple, so it’s easy to use, even for beginners.

Cambridge English Activities for Learners

The Cambridge English "Activities for Learners" platform offers over 80 free online activities designed to help learners of all ages and proficiency levels practice and improve their English skills. These activities cover various aspects of language learning, including reading, writing, listening, speaking, grammar, and vocabulary, and are aligned with the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R) levels from A1 to C2.

Users can personalize their learning experience by selecting their proficiency level, the skill they wish to practice, and the amount of time they have available. The platform then suggests suitable activities, making it a flexible and user-friendly resource for both self-study and classroom use.

For educators, this platform serves as a valuable tool to supplement teaching materials and provide students with additional practice opportunities. It can be integrated into lesson plans or assigned as homework to reinforce language skills.

Tune Into English

Tune Into English is a free educational website that helps learners improve their English through music. It offers a variety of resources for both teachers and students, including:​

Worksheets: Over 400 downloadable lesson plans based on popular songs, focusing on grammar, vocabulary, and listening skills. ​

Games and Activities: Interactive exercises and quizzes that make learning English fun and engaging. ​

Roadshows: Live interactive shows presented in schools across Europe, combining language learning with pop music. ​

The site is managed by Fergal Kavanagh, an experienced English teacher who integrates his passion for music into language education.

EU 2025: The future demand for English language in the European Union

The aim of this project was to quantify and describe the future demand for English language teaching and learning to 2025 and beyond in seven European countries.

The project was carried out in late 2017 and early 2018 by Trajectory, an independent research consultancy specialising in strategic trends analysis and forecasting. The approach is mixed method combining literature review, quantitative analysis of secondary data and qualitative research.

According to this British Council's 2018 report,  the number of potential English language learners in seven EU countries—France, Greece, Italy, Poland, Portugal, Romania, and Spain—is projected to decrease by approximately 15.3 million by 2025. This decline is attributed to demographic changes and an increasing number of adults already possessing higher levels of English proficiency.

Despite this reduction, English is expected to maintain its status as the EU's lingua franca. Employers will continue to seek employees with advanced English skills for tasks such as negotiations, problem-solving, and strategic presentations. Consequently, adults may require ongoing "top-up" tuition throughout their careers, leading to a demand for more flexible, personalized, and efficient learning methods. Traditional long-term courses may see a decline in favor of these adaptable learning solutions. Additionally, older learners may pursue English studies to stay mentally active, travel, or communicate with family abroad.
